Definition   
Thayer's
Amon = "builder"
  1. a king of Judah, son of Manasseh, and father of Josiah

Thayer's Expanded Definition

Ἀμών, , indeclinable, Amon (אָמון artificer (but cf. B. D.)), king of Judah, son of Manasseh, and father of Josiah: Matthew 1:10 (L T Tr WH Ἀμώς. Cf. B. D.).
